A-366

response biomarkers — cross-omics
Drug responseDRUG → SHRNACell line

Across CCLE and GDSC cell-line panels, response to A-366 is significantly associated with the shRNA dependency of multiple gene dependencies, with CNS cell lines showing a particularly strong set of associations.

The most reproducible A-366 response-associated gene dependencies across cancer lineages are B3GALT4, C1QBP, and USF2, each associated with drug response in up to 8 lineages. Since the analysis identifies associations rather than directional relationships, both response-to-biomarker and biomarker-to-response views are provided.

Each biomarker is linked to its corresponding Q-omics profile. The scatter plot shows the strongest observed association, A-366 response versus B3GALT4 shRNA dependency in CNS (Pearson r = -0.71).
